@spacekookie@octodon.social The problem is that it got rushedly implemented 'experimentally' without clearly marking it as such, people got excited about the problems it *does* solve, started using it...

... and then overlooked the whole stability thing, kinda dropped support for "explaining to nebiews how to do stuff without flakes", and the RFC process was also pretty much bypassed. It's irritating.

(I feel like this is at least partly a rehash of a longer-standing problem in the Nix community, where people get so excited about all the complex stuff they can do, and kinda forget to leave the ladder out behind them for newbies. Leading to missing docs etc.)

Flakes *should* be redone through the RFC process, properly this time. There have been some noises that this is on the table. Remains to be seen whether it actually happens :/
